The Mechanics of Compressed Video Files: How Do They Work?

Compressing video files involves reducing the file size while maintaining the quality of the video. This is achieved through various algorithms and techniques that eliminate unnecessary data, such as redundant frames, audio tracks, and other metadata. The result is a smaller file size that's easier to store, share, and stream.

When compressing video files, you have three primary options: lossless, lossy, and hybrid compression. Lossless compression retains the original quality of the video, but the file size may not be significantly reduced. Lossy compression, on the other hand, discards some of the data, resulting in a smaller file size but potentially compromising video quality. Hybrid compression combines the benefits of both approaches, offering a balance between file size and quality.

Squeezing Hours into Minutes: 5 Easy Steps to Compress Video Files on Your MacBook

Navigating the world of compressed video files can be intimidating, especially if you're new to video editing and compression. Fortunately, compressing video files on your MacBook is easier than you think. Here are 5 easy steps to help you get started:

  1. Choose a video editing software: Select a video editing software that supports compression, such as Final Cut Pro, Adobe Premiere Pro, or DaVinci Resolve.
  2. Import your video file: Import your video file into the video editing software, making sure to select the desired compression settings.
  3. Select the compression algorithm: Choose a compression algorithm that suits your needs, such as H.264 or H.265.
  4. Set the file size: Adjust the file size to your desired level, taking into account the quality and compression settings.
  5. Export your compressed video file: Export your compressed video file, ready to be shared or streamed online.

With these 5 easy steps, you can create compressed video files that are perfect for sharing, streaming, or collaborating with others.
